A Milwaukee infant was found dead and wrapped in a blanket on the shoulder of a highway in southern Minnesota after a days-long search, police say.

Get breaking news alerts and special reports. The news and stories that matter, delivered weekday mornings.A Milwaukee infant has been found dead and wrapped in a blanket on the shoulder of a highway in southern Minnesota after a days-long search, police said during a press conference on Saturday.

Police believe the body that was found is that of Noelani Robinson, 2, who went missing on Monday. Officials said an autopsy will be performed to ultimately conclude her identity and her manner of death.The body was found after an off-duty employee of the Department of Public Works spotted something abnormal on the shoulder of a highway, Milwaukee Police Department Chief Alfonso Morales said on Saturday.Milwaukee Police Dept.

Morales said officers do not believe Noelani was killed within the last 24 hours, and that she had been on the side of the road for"quite some time."
